site stats

Java parallel stream internal working

Web25 feb. 2024 · At least we defeated serial java stream on this workload. To find parallel code in Streams we must look at AbstractPipeline#evaluate(TerminalOp terminalOp)which is called on terminal ... Web25 apr. 2024 · A stream is executed sequentially or in parallel depending on the execution mode of the stream on which the terminal operation is initiated. The Stream API makes …

How does Parallel Stream work in Java & Examples

Web-Extensively used Java 8 features such as lambda expressions, Parallel operations on collections, multithreading and for effective sorting mechanisms and Streams to store and process the data. WebA parallel stream is a parallel flow of objects that supports various functions which can be intended to produce the expected output. Parallel stream is not a data structure that … the garden bar atlanta https://jamconsultpro.com

Debugging Java 8 Streams with IntelliJ Baeldung

Web1 apr. 2024 · Exploring Java 8/7 : Internal working of Streams. Hello there techies, Hope you are doing good. Welcome to Programming4ninja and Exploring Java 8 Series. … Web29 aug. 2024 · This allows us to speed up the code execution and use hardware more efficiently. Parallel computation contains 3 faces: split, apply, and combine. The split or fork face partitions the task into ... Web12 mar. 2024 · This tutorial will guide you What is parallel stream and its internal flow with hands on live coding #javatechie #Java8 #ParallStreamjava 8 playlist : h... the amity affliction art

Parallelizing Streams - Dev.java

Category:Java 8 Parallel Streams Parallel data processing and …

Tags:Java parallel stream internal working

Java parallel stream internal working

Distributed Object Computing (DOC) Group for DRE Systems

WebIn this video shown an example of parallel stream.-----stream vs parallel streamparallel strea... Web2 aug. 2015 · 41. I wrote code using Java 8 streams and parallel streams for the same functionality with a custom collector to perform an aggregation function. When I see CPU …

Java parallel stream internal working

Did you know?

Web25 apr. 2024 · A stream is executed sequentially or in parallel depending on the execution mode of the stream on which the terminal operation is initiated. The Stream API makes it possible to execute a sequential stream in parallel without rewriting the code. The primary reason for using parallel streams is to improve performance while at the same time ... WebThe parallel () method of the IntStream class in Java returns an equivalent parallel stream. The method may return itself, either because the stream was already parallel, or …

Web22 ian. 2024 · Using the parallel () method on a stream. E.g. 1. Optional calcProd = list1.parallelStream ().reduce ( (a,b) -> a*b)); In this code, a parallel stream is … Web29 mar. 2024 · The parallel () call triggers the fork-join mechanism on the stream of numbers. It splits the stream to run in four threads. Once each thread has a stream, the mechanism calls reduce () on each to run in concurrence. Then, the results from every reduce () aggregates into intermediate results: r5 and r6:

WebDistributed Object Computing (DOC) Group for DRE Systems Web3 aug. 2024 · To overcome all the above shortcomings, Java 8 Stream API was introduced. We can use Java Stream API to implement internal iteration, that is better because java …

Web22 iul. 2024 · You can check via command line: java -XX:+PrintFlagsFinal -version grep ThreadStackSize. Option 1: You can create a class that inherits the Thread.java class. Option 2: You can use a Runnable ...

Web24 dec. 2024 · Video. Java Parallel Streams is a feature of Java 8 and higher, meant for utilizing multiple cores of the processor. Normally any java code has one stream of … the garden bar bownessWeb23 apr. 2024 · Java 8 introduces the concept of the parallel stream to do parallel processing. As we have a number of CPU cores nowadays due to cheap hardware … the amity affliction clothingWeb30 nov. 2024 · Note that the java doc states parallelStream() "Returns a possibly parallel Stream with this collection as its source. It is allowable for this method to return a … the amity affliction death\u0027s hand lyricsWeb24 iun. 2024 · Now that we've introduced the stream debugging functionality in IntelliJ, it's time to work with some code examples. 3.1. Basic Example with a Sorted Stream. Let's start with a simple code fragment to get used to the Stream Trace dialog: int [] listOutputSorted = IntStream.of (- 3, 10, - 4, 1, 3 ) .sorted () .toArray (); the garden bar grove cityWebFor instance, limit() needs an internal counter to work correctly. In parallel, this internal counter is shared among different threads. Sharing a mutable state between threads is costly and should be avoided. Understanding the Overhead of Computing a Stream in Parallel. Computing a stream in parallel adds some computations to handle parallelism. the garden bar montonWeb3 apr. 2024 · Introduction. In computer programming, an iterator is an object that enables a programmer to traverse a container, particularly lists.. The Iterator interface is part of the Java Collections Framework and provides a way to traverse elements in a collection in a sequential manner. It is used to loop through collections like List, Set, and Map, and … the garden bar hilliardWebFor instance, limit() needs an internal counter to work correctly. In parallel, this internal counter is shared among different threads. Sharing a mutable state between threads is … the garden bar houston tx